I have been working on placing the speaker inside the aerator instead of in the very common location of earholes. I have this bizarre fetish with NOT doing things the same as everyone else. I found a speaker that will fit, stuck it in the aerator, and did some testing. The problem I had was with feedback. If the mic was anywhere near my mouth it was too close to the speaker. While at TK-5108's place doing an armor party last night, he suggested I use something to seal the speaker from the helmet. The way the helmet is constructed there is a 1/2" hole through which sound may travel directly behind the speaker. We brainstormed for a minute and came up with modeling clay. I snagged some of that on my way home today.
All I can say is, "Sweeet," and, "Duuude!" With the mic directly against the clay there is a slight resonance, but aside from that we are golden.
